What Makes Welding So Demanding?

Before diving into the motivational quotes, let's acknowledge the inherent challenges of welding that make these words of encouragement so crucial. Welding isn't just about melting metal; it's about precision, safety, and the ability to withstand intense heat and physical demands. The job often requires long hours in sometimes uncomfortable positions, demanding both physical and mental strength. The pressure to create strong, flawless welds adds another layer of complexity. It's a job that requires constant learning, adaptation, and a relentless pursuit of perfection.

Motivational Welding Quotes to Fuel Your Passion

Here are some inspiring quotes designed to resonate with the spirit of a welder:

  • "A good welder is an artist who creates strength where there was once weakness." This quote highlights the artistic and problem-solving aspects of welding, transforming raw materials into functional and beautiful structures.

  • "The heat of the moment creates the strength of the weld." This emphasizes the importance of focus and precision during the welding process—a moment of intense concentration resulting in a robust final product.

  • "Welders: We don't just build things, we build futures." This quote elevates the profession, connecting welding work to the larger impact it has on society.

  • "Every weld is a testament to skill, patience, and dedication." This acknowledges the hard work and commitment involved in mastering the art of welding.
